There is no word from Epic Games or Psyonix at this stage, but we presume investigations are underway.

At the moment players are seeming to be able to get into the game itself but only Freeplay and Training maps work. The item shop, any kind of lobby or invite, or any other game mode just results in the message “Epic Servers are down, please try again in a couple of minutes.

Also, on training maps, you only seem to be able to play maps you have favorited, which suggests they must have saved some key information locally.

Also interestingly, anybody who seems to have logged into the game a couple of hours ago and stayed in are not reporting issues.
